
CITY OF KINGSLAND HONORS CITY MANAGER LEE H. SPELL FOR 40 YEARS OF DISTINGUISHED PUBLIC SERVICE
KINGSLAND, GA — The City of Kingsland proudly recognizes Mr. Lee H. Spell for achieving an extraordinary milestone—40 years of dedicated public service on October 1, 2025.
“It is both an honor and a privilege to recognize a truly remarkable individual as he celebrates this incredible achievement,” said Mayor Day. “Lee Spell’s four decades of service exemplify integrity, dedication, and an unwavering commitment to the people of Kingsland.”
The ceremony was opened by Georgia State Representative Steven Sainz (District 180) who presented and read a formal resolution from the Georgia House of Representatives, commending Mr. Spell for his distinguished career and lasting contributions to local government.

Lee’s career in public service began in 1985 with the Glynn County Board of Commissioners, where he worked in Public Works Administration for ten years. During this time, he held multiple positions—including crew worker, radio dispatcher, and data entry clerk—showcasing his versatility and strong work ethic from the start.
In October 1995, Lee joined the City of Kingsland as the Information Technology Director, later taking on additional responsibilities overseeing Water Billing and Business Licensing. His adaptability and leadership quickly became evident to all who worked alongside him.
Lee went on to establish and lead Kingsland’s Human Resources Department, serving as HR Director for nearly 19 years. In this role, he developed the city’s classification and compensation systems, managed recruitment and employee relations, implemented training programs, and oversaw risk management and insurance administration—all with a steadfast focus on the well-being of city employees and residents.
His proven leadership and deep understanding of municipal operations led to additional leadership roles, including Interim City Manager and Assistant City Manager. In June 2014, Lee was appointed City Manager by the Mayor and Council—a position he has held with distinction for more than 11 years. Remarkably, he continued to balance his HR Director duties alongside his duties as City Manager, exemplifying tireless commitment to the City of Kingsland and its citizens.
As City Manager, Lee has guided the city through numerous challenges and opportunities with strategic vision and calm leadership. He oversees all city departments, manages budget development, and leads both short- and long-range planning initiatives.
